Scopely seems to keep changing how the usual Peg-E prize drop events work, with a second new type of Peg-E Prize Drop happening in the same month! While earlier in November, we played the Sticker Drop iteration, this weekend, we’re in for the Deluxe Drop iteration instead, which offers a few different kinds of prizes that we don’t normally see from Peg-E events.
This time around, Peg-E is offeringnew emojisofvarious characters from the Marvel Universeas we enter the home stretch for the Marvel Go sticker album season, anew shield skinfeaturing The Hulk, and a newboard tokenofMystique from the X-Men and Ms. Marvel series. Not only are there the standard aesthetic rewards on offer from the early December Peg-E Deluxe Drop, but there’s also a new aesthetic choice recently introduced to Monopoly Go:new dice skins.
Like how you’re able to change the appearance of your board token and shields, you can now change the appearance of your game’s two dice as well! These track in your gallery like emojis and other collectibles, so check out your gallery to see all the fun aesthetics you’ve collected!
The December Peg-E Deluxe Drop is the first chance we have to earn new dice skins, with a different option for new dice skins in Monopoly Go available as the top prize on each page of rewards for the event, which we’ll detail more in-depth in the table below. There have been a ton of changes to Peg-E lately, and the early December Deluxe Drop is no exception! We’ve now gottwo bumperson the board again, but they’re nowhorizontal from one another instead of vertical, both in the center of the board and both offering additional points for each time you hit them. We’ve also got a rearrangement of the obstacle pegs on the board, with one frustratingly right above the bumpers, and several along the bottom slots where you earn your highest number of points.
To play the Peg-E Deluxe Drop event, you’ll need tocollect Peg-E tokens from other Monopoly Go eventsthat run in tandem with the Peg-E event. These include thecenter banner events(which is Super Soiree for the duration of the Deluxe Drop event), thedaily leaderboard tournamentsas your milestone rewards there, completing daily quick win tasks when they refresh at 8AM EST each day, and even yourlog-in bonusthat refreshes in the store every eight hours.
